Movies that have a scene like this
A friend of mine asked me if I knew of any movies (preferably B&W) with a scene where a kid is holding up a newspaper and yelling "Extra! Extra! Read all about it."
Well, still recovering from Christmas shenanigans I was stumped. So I'm looking for some examples.

Here are the quotes containing extra extra read all about it
1. "Coconut Fred's Fruit Salad Island!" (2005)
Coconut Fred: Extra, Extra! Mr. Greenrind denies booger farming. [shouts] Read all about it! [throws a newspaper at Mr. Greenrind]
2. "Grey's Anatomy" (2005) {Let It Be (#2.8)}
Dr. Meredith Grey: In the eight grade my English class had to read Romeo and Juliet. Then for extra credit, Ms. Synder made us act out all the parts. Sal Scafarillo was Romeo and as fate would have it, I was Juliet. All the other girls were jealous, but I had a slightly different take. I told Ms. Synder Juliet was an idiot. For starters she falls for the one guy she knows she can't have, then she blames fate for her own bad decision. Ms. Synder explained to me that when fate comes into play choice sometimes goes out the window. At the ripe old age of 13 I was very clear that love, like life, is about making choices, and fate has nothing to do with it. Everyone thinks it's so romantic. Romeo and Juliet, true love, how sad. If Juliet was stupid enough to fall for the enemy, drink the bottle of the poison and go to sleep in a mausoleum. She deserved whatever she got!
3. "Monkees, The" (1966) {The Devil and Peter Tork (#2.20)}
Micky: [dressed as a newsboy] Extra! Extra! Read all about it! Rock and roll group gains fame and fortune by introducing harp into act!
4. "That '70s Show" (1998)
Eric: Extra. Extra. Read all about it.
5. Happy-Go-Nutty (1944)
Screwy Squirrel: [At the bottom of the cliff, holding a newspaper] Extra! Extra! Read all about it! Dumb dog falls for corny old gag! Extra! [Meathead lands] Paper, mister? [Hands Meathead paper; headline reads "Sucker!"]
6. Overnight Delivery (1998)
Ivy: Extra, Extra. Read all about it. Kim can shake her pom-poms but she won't go at it! Extraaa. Extraaa.
